We left Laos behind on a wet Monday & ventured back into Thailand. After a brief stop in the riverside town of Nong Khai we catch the first of two overnight trains to Malaysia. Towards the end of our journey we get into conversation with a Malaysian chap who turns out to be a real character. He talks at us periodically over a few hours.
